Ingredients

  • 250 g Flour t55
  • 125 g Salted butter
  • 75 g Granulated sugar
  • 1 Egg
  • 1 Teaspoon(s) Lemon zest
  • 1 Teaspoon(s) Baking powder
  • 25 g Milk
  • 50 g Raisin
  • 10 g Pearl sugar

Steps

Dough

  1. Add 250 g of flour t55, 125 g of salted butter in the food processor bowl.
  2. Mix manual: 20sec / 0°C / Speed 5.
  3. Add 75 g of granulated sugar, 1 egg, 1 teaspoon(s) of lemon zest, 1 teaspoon(s) of baking powder in the food processor bowl.
  4. Mix manual: 15sec / 0°C / Speed 4.
  5. Add 25 g of milk, 50 g of raisin in the food processor bowl.
  6. Mix manual: 10sec / 0°C / Speed 3.
  7. Transfer the content of the food processor bowl on a workplan.
  8. Gently form the dough into a ball.

Shaping and Baking

  1. Preheat the oven at 180°C.
  2. Place the content of the baking paper on a baking tray.
  3. Divide the dough into five equal portions.
  4. Gently flatten each portion into a round, slightly flattened shape (about 1 cm thick).
  5. Place the content of the preparation content on the baking tray.
  6. Sprinkle 10 g of pearl sugar on some dough.
  7. Cook on the oven at 180°C during 15min.
  8. Bake for 15-20 minutes, or until golden brown.
  9. Setaside the preparation content on the baking tray let cool during 15min.
  10. Transfer the content of the baking tray let cool.
